Turn menu_settings_list_current_add_enum_idx into public scope
function so we can use it in gfx/video_driver.c
This commit is contained in:
parent
177c96a382
commit
dd04705d25
|
@ -1191,6 +1191,7 @@ void video_driver_menu_settings(void **list_data, void *list_info_data,
|
||||||
group_info,
|
group_info,
|
||||||
subgroup_info,
|
subgroup_info,
|
||||||
parent_group);
|
parent_group);
|
||||||
|
menu_settings_list_current_add_enum_idx(list, list_info, MENU_ENUM_LABEL_SCREEN_RESOLUTION);
|
||||||
#endif
|
#endif
|
||||||
#if defined(__CELLOS_LV2__)
|
#if defined(__CELLOS_LV2__)
|
||||||
CONFIG_BOOL(
|
CONFIG_BOOL(
|
||||||
|
@ -1206,6 +1207,7 @@ void video_driver_menu_settings(void **list_data, void *list_info_data,
|
||||||
parent_group,
|
parent_group,
|
||||||
general_write_handler,
|
general_write_handler,
|
||||||
general_read_handler);
|
general_read_handler);
|
||||||
|
menu_settings_list_current_add_enum_idx(list, list_info, MENU_ENUM_LABEL_PAL60_ENABLE);
|
||||||
#endif
|
#endif
|
||||||
#if defined(GEKKO) || defined(_XBOX360)
|
#if defined(GEKKO) || defined(_XBOX360)
|
||||||
CONFIG_UINT(
|
CONFIG_UINT(
|
||||||
|
@ -1233,6 +1235,7 @@ void video_driver_menu_settings(void **list_data, void *list_info_data,
|
||||||
true);
|
true);
|
||||||
settings_data_list_current_add_flags(list, list_info,
|
settings_data_list_current_add_flags(list, list_info,
|
||||||
SD_FLAG_CMD_APPLY_AUTO|SD_FLAG_ADVANCED);
|
SD_FLAG_CMD_APPLY_AUTO|SD_FLAG_ADVANCED);
|
||||||
|
menu_settings_list_current_add_enum_idx(list, list_info, MENU_ENUM_LABEL_VIDEO_GAMMA);
|
||||||
#endif
|
#endif
|
||||||
#if defined(_XBOX1) || defined(HW_RVL)
|
#if defined(_XBOX1) || defined(HW_RVL)
|
||||||
CONFIG_BOOL(
|
CONFIG_BOOL(
|
||||||
|
@ -1252,6 +1255,7 @@ void video_driver_menu_settings(void **list_data, void *list_info_data,
|
||||||
list,
|
list,
|
||||||
list_info,
|
list_info,
|
||||||
CMD_EVENT_VIDEO_APPLY_STATE_CHANGES);
|
CMD_EVENT_VIDEO_APPLY_STATE_CHANGES);
|
||||||
|
menu_settings_list_current_add_enum_idx(list, list_info, MENU_ENUM_LABEL_VIDEO_SOFT_FILTER);
|
||||||
#endif
|
#endif
|
||||||
#ifdef _XBOX1
|
#ifdef _XBOX1
|
||||||
CONFIG_UINT(
|
CONFIG_UINT(
|
||||||
|
@ -1266,6 +1270,7 @@ void video_driver_menu_settings(void **list_data, void *list_info_data,
|
||||||
general_write_handler,
|
general_write_handler,
|
||||||
general_read_handler);
|
general_read_handler);
|
||||||
menu_settings_list_current_add_range(list, list_info, 0, 5, 1, true, true);
|
menu_settings_list_current_add_range(list, list_info, 0, 5, 1, true, true);
|
||||||
|
menu_settings_list_current_add_enum_idx(list, list_info, MENU_ENUM_LABEL_VIDEO_FILTER_FLICKER);
|
||||||
#endif
|
#endif
|
||||||
#endif
|
#endif
|
||||||
}
|
}
|
||||||
|
|
|
@ -1833,7 +1833,7 @@ void menu_settings_list_current_add_cmd(
|
||||||
(*list)[idx].cmd_trigger.idx = values;
|
(*list)[idx].cmd_trigger.idx = values;
|
||||||
}
|
}
|
||||||
|
|
||||||
static void menu_settings_list_current_add_enum_idx(
|
void menu_settings_list_current_add_enum_idx(
|
||||||
rarch_setting_t **list,
|
rarch_setting_t **list,
|
||||||
rarch_setting_info_t *list_info,
|
rarch_setting_info_t *list_info,
|
||||||
enum menu_hash_enums enum_idx)
|
enum menu_hash_enums enum_idx)
|
||||||
|
|
|
@ -386,6 +386,11 @@ void settings_data_list_current_add_free_flags(
|
||||||
rarch_setting_info_t *list_info,
|
rarch_setting_info_t *list_info,
|
||||||
unsigned values);
|
unsigned values);
|
||||||
|
|
||||||
|
void menu_settings_list_current_add_enum_idx(
|
||||||
|
rarch_setting_t **list,
|
||||||
|
rarch_setting_info_t *list_info,
|
||||||
|
enum menu_hash_enums enum_idx);
|
||||||
|
|
||||||
bool menu_setting_ctl(enum menu_setting_ctl_state state, void *data);
|
bool menu_setting_ctl(enum menu_setting_ctl_state state, void *data);
|
||||||
|
|
||||||
RETRO_END_DECLS
|
RETRO_END_DECLS
|
||||||
|
|
Loading…
Reference in New Issue